Keeping Mission Control Moving

At Space Center Houston, space is the place but keeping that place running requires plenty of work on the ground. As the educational arm and visitor center for NASA’s Johnson Space Center in Houston, Space Center Houston welcomes more than 1.2 million guests each year. Opened in 1993, the facility is home to iconic experiences including Mission Control and the Neutral Buoyancy Laboratory. Behind the scenes, a diverse facilities team keeps the campus operating safely and reliably. Their responsibilities include daily operations, grounds, custodial services, maintenance, engineering, mechanical systems, tram operations, and major capital projects.

With decades of changes and upgrades, the team faced one fundamental question: How well do we really know the building?

The Challenge: Decades of Knowledge, Scattered Everywhere

Over nearly three decades, Space Center Houston accumulated enormous institutional knowledge. The problem was that much of it lived in people’s heads or in disconnected physical documents.

“We've made so many decisions over the last 30 years that none of them were documented.”

Drawings could turn up in unexpected places—inside closets, in storage, or even on top of an air handler. When an issue occurred, staff often depended on specific employees or contractors to know what was where and how systems worked.

That created operational risk. If there was an emergency in a particular zone, the answer might be as simple as calling the person who knew the system. But that approach wasn't scalable. The team needed to move from institutional memory to institutional knowledge—a centralized source of truth that could empower everyone.

The Solution: Putting the Building at Everyone’s Fingertips

Space Center Houston implemented a digital building documentation program to consolidate drawings, plans, equipment information, and operational knowledge into one platform. The goal was straightforward: centralize everything. Instead of returning to an office to search through files—or relying on someone else to remember where information lived—the team could pull up critical building information from the field.

That was especially valuable for a facility with a 250,000-square-foot roof requiring continual attention. The team could pin-drop roof leaks, document their locations, and associate them with work tickets, creating a clearer connection between facility conditions and maintenance work.

From Reactive to Ready

The transformation wasn't simply about digitizing documents. It changed how the facilities team worked. With information centralized, technicians no longer had to depend on scattered drawings or individual memory to understand the building.

They could pull up information:

  • From the office
  • From home
  • Directly from the floor
  • While responding to an active issue

That became especially important when Space Center Houston experienced a water main break. Because the team had already invested in documenting and organizing the facility, they could identify the relevant information and respond much faster.

What could have become a four- to five-day problem was resolved in roughly a day and a half. The difference came from preparation. By documenting the building in advance, the team reduced the time spent searching, coordinating, and figuring out what to do next when an issue occurred.
